    Financing Your Honda Purchase

    So, financing your Honda purchase is something you should consider. Most dealerships offer financing options, but it's a good idea to shop around and compare rates. Credit unions and banks can also offer competitive loans. Be sure to factor in interest rates, loan terms, and any fees when you're crunching the numbers. Understanding your financing options is essential to making an informed decision about your Honda purchase. Dealership financing can be convenient, but it's always a good idea to compare rates from other lenders, such as credit unions and banks. Credit unions often offer lower interest rates and more flexible terms than traditional banks, while banks may offer a wider range of loan products and services. When comparing loan options, pay attention to the interest rate, loan term, and any fees or charges. A lower interest rate can save you money over the life of the loan, while a shorter loan term will result in higher monthly payments but less interest paid overall. Be sure to factor in any fees, such as origination fees or prepayment penalties, when calculating the total cost of the loan. Before applying for a car loan, check your credit score and address any errors or issues. A good credit score can help you qualify for a lower interest rate and better loan terms. If you have a low credit score, consider taking steps to improve it before applying for a loan. This could include paying down debt, disputing errors on your credit report, and avoiding new credit applications.

    Maintaining Your Honda

    Maintaining your Honda is key to keeping it running smoothly for years to come. Regular servicing is a must. Follow the manufacturer's recommended maintenance schedule. Keep an eye on fluids. Check your oil, coolant, brake fluid, and power steering fluid regularly. Address any problems promptly. Don't ignore warning lights or unusual noises. Keep it clean. A clean car is a happy car! Regular servicing is essential for keeping your Honda running smoothly and efficiently. Follow the manufacturer's recommended maintenance schedule, which typically includes oil changes, filter replacements, and inspections of various components. Keeping an eye on fluids is also crucial. Check your oil, coolant, brake fluid, and power steering fluid regularly and top them off as needed. Low fluid levels can lead to serious engine damage or brake failure. Address any problems promptly. Don't ignore warning lights or unusual noises, as they could be signs of a more serious issue. Ignoring these issues can lead to costly repairs down the road. Keeping your Honda clean is also important for maintaining its appearance and value. Wash your car regularly to remove dirt, grime, and road salt. Wax it periodically to protect the paint from the elements. Clean the interior regularly to prevent stains and odors. By following these maintenance tips, you can keep your Honda running smoothly and looking its best for years to come.
